Output 3ad276a74688cbc16ff72074c50f9bfd82025088ec174d15af73c04232f498a0:2

value
18690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6385b689611e7b782108ffbd1bbc7b0c156aec4b OP_EQUAL
address
3AmF15ZSENvLkNzbwc9fVytAQfTTikEgJ9
transaction
3ad276a74688cbc16ff72074c50f9bfd82025088ec174d15af73c04232f498a0
spent
true